Curling or Buckling Roofing Shingles



In some cases, you might observe curling or buckling roof shingles on your roofing, which's a clear sign something's incorrect. This issue typically shows that your roof shingles are maturing or have been endangered. When tiles curl, they shed their performance, permitting water to leak underneath them, potentially causing leakages and additional damages.


You should take notice of whether the curling is taking place at the edges or in the middle of the shingles. Edges crinkling upwards suggest that your tiles are drying, while those curling downwards might show moisture problems beneath the surface.

Distorting shingles, on the other hand, might indicate that your roofing system's underlayment isn't supplying appropriate assistance, which can cause architectural issues with time.

Overlooking these signs can intensify issues, leading to expensive repair work. If you see curling or buckling roof shingles, it's important to check your roofing much more very closely.

Consider reaching out to a roof expert who can examine the circumstance accurately. They can figure out whether you need a simple repair work or a complete roof substitute.

Granules in Gutters



Granules in your seamless gutters can signify that your roofing is nearing the end of its life expectancy. https://metalroofinglowes62727.dreamyblogs.com/34791988/10-indicators-that-your-roofing-system-needs-substitute-understand-these-indication , loose fragments generally originate from asphalt roof shingles, which normally wear down gradually. If you observe a buildup of granules, it's an indicator that your shingles are degrading and may no more be supplying ample defense for your home.

As you examine your seamless gutters, take note of the amount of granules existing. A few granules here and there can be normal, especially after a storm. However, if you locate a significant buildup or if your seamless gutters are regularly filled with these bits, it's time to take action.

Granules offer a vital function-- they aid protect your tiles from UV rays and contribute to their total sturdiness. When they start to remove, your roof ends up being a lot more prone to damages.

Roofing Age



The life expectancy of your roof covering plays a vital role in determining whether it needs substitute. Most roof coverings last in between 20 to thirty years, depending on the materials utilized and neighborhood climate conditions. If your roof covering is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to take into consideration a substitute.

You mightn't need to await noticeable damages to make a decision. Routine assessments can assist you capture any kind of possible problems early on. If you understand the age of your roof covering and it's coming close to the end of its life-span, stay aggressive. Try to find signs of wear and tear, such as curling shingles or granule loss.

Also, think about the kind of roofing product you have. Asphalt roof shingles, as an example, might wear faster than metal or ceramic tile roof coverings.
